JavaScript输出问题
探索JavaScript的输入与输出艺术:解锁人机交互的神奇力量在编程的世界里,人机交互就像一场无声的交响乐,而JavaScript就是指挥这场乐章的指挥棒。它巧妙地连接着用户输入的琴键,通过一系列内置函数,如document.write()、alert()和console.log(),将信息输出,为用户带来实时反馈。
首先,从HTML的定义与书写规则角度上来讲ID是元素的唯一属性,而且他的属性不一定唯一 这个不是两个输出方法,这应该是两个取值方法。输出是指向显示器、音响等反馈设备发出信息的一系列动作。
document.write()方法和document.writeln()方法 document是JavaScript中的一个对象在它中封装许多有用的方法,其中write()和writeln()就是用于将文本信息直接输出到浏览器窗口中的方法。
window.onload事件执行这个函数时,文档流已经关闭。这时在document.write会重新创建一个文档流,并覆盖当前的文档,这时document指向的引用已经不存在了。所以会出错。
你的代码没问题。因为hello.php是直接输出这段语句,但你这行代码没有放在中执行,那么输出结果是直接是:document.write(HelloWorld);而test.html正则引用了hello.php的执行结果,并作为JS来运行,那么你直接打开test.htm就会输出HelloWorld。
第一个循环依次输入 a, b b=[a, b];第二个循环依次输入 c, d b=[c, d];a 的内容就是 a = [[a, b],[c, d]];简单地说,就是数组里面套数组。alert(a) 应该显示 a,b,c,d。
JavaScript循环语句输出1到100的五种方法有哪些!
let num = 2;while (num = 100) { console.log(num);num += 2;} 在这个代码中,我们声明了一个变量 num 并将其初始值设置为 2。接着,我们使用 while 循环,其中的条件是 num = 100。每次循环,我们都会输出 num 的值,并将其加上 2。
arr.push(i);} });} console.log(arr);在这段代码中,我们首先创建一个空数组 arr。然后,使用 for 循环遍历 1-100 范围内的每个数字。对于每个数字,我们将其转换为字符串,并将其分成两个部分,分别存储在两个数组中。
在上述代码中,使用了一个 for 循环,从 1 开始遍历到 100。每遍历到一个数字,就判断它是否能被 5 整除,如果不能,就将它加入到统计的总和中。最后,使用 console.log 输出总和。运行上述代码后,您将会在控制台中看到输出的总和。
for(var i = 2;i = 100;i+=2){ /* 定义一个变量i存储当前的偶数;当i小于等于100时执行下面的累加语句 ;执行完累加语句之后i变量自增2继续判断-累加。
var hehe = Math.floor(Math.random()*40)+60;alert(hehe);顺便说下,我楼上写的是一句正常的js代码。Math是js里面自有的一个数学对象。它的floor方法去小数,random方法生成0-1的小数。*表示乘法,+表示加法。
用javascript实现输入输出的问题?
探索JavaScript的输入与输出艺术:解锁人机交互的神奇力量在编程的世界里,人机交互就像一场无声的交响乐,而JavaScript就是指挥这场乐章的指挥棒。它巧妙地连接着用户输入的琴键,通过一系列内置函数,如document.write()、alert()和console.log(),将信息输出,为用户带来实时反馈。
document.write()方法和document.writeln()方法 document是JavaScript中的一个对象在它中封装许多有用的方法,其中write()和writeln()就是用于将文本信息直接输出到浏览器窗口中的方法。
定义一个 decomposeEvenNumber 函数,用于从键盘输入一个大于4的偶数,并将其分解成两个素数之和;在 decomposeEvenNumber 函数中,先从键盘输入一个大于4的偶数,并进行合法性检查;然后使用循环遍历从 2 到 n/2 的所有整数 i,找到一个满足 i 和 n-i 都是素数的组合;输出找到的分解式。